TideFrame widget onboarding — security review scope. The widget polls the Moonharbor tide-table service every 15 minutes over mTLS. No user data leaves the embed. Cache is in-memory only, cleared on reload. Review the fetch layer in tideframe/core before approving. To reproduce calls against the staging endpoint, use the key below.

app token of yajeg-kawef = kto11_7En3XSX8xQw

## Changelog — Ticktrace 1.9

### Renamed: DRIFT_API_TOKEN
During the cron drift investigation we found plugins confusing this variable with the metrics token, so it has been renamed to indicate it authorizes drift-report uploads specifically. Plugin authors must read the new name from 1.9 onward; the old name is ignored without warning. Sample env files in the SDK are updated. In your deployment env file, the drift-report upload secret is set on the next line.

env line for fawef-taguf: VAULT_KEY13=a9695905a9a90

### TICKET-4471: Template rendering regression — sign-off required

Rendering latency on the Quillpress template engine rose from 45ms to 190ms p95 after the partial-caching change shipped. A revert is staged and verified in pre-prod; dashboards confirm latency returns to baseline. On-call should monitor render queue depth for one hour post-deploy and confirm no stale-template reports. Rollback plan is documented in the runbook. Deployment cannot proceed without sign-off from the service owner identified below.

named custodian: Brivan Eliath Quenox Frador

Handover note — Crumbwheel order cutoffs.

Welcome aboard. The bakery cutoff rule in Crumbwheel closes same-day orders at 14:00 local to each storefront, not UTC — this has bitten us twice. Holiday overrides live in the calendar service and take precedence silently, so always check there first when a cutoff looks wrong. To unlock the calendar service's admin console after a restart, enter the recovery passphrase below.

vault phrase of bagap-bahaf = silion-pelox-sorox-casdor-quenwyn-fraax-eliox-praael-kelion-quenvan-kasox-rusael-norius-belvan